CHECK INITIAL CHECK FUNCTION
Check the initial check function for the sensor.
Approximately 0.4 seconds after the ignition switch is turned to ON and the back sonar or clearance sonar switch is turned on, all the sensors are checked by the system.
When the shift lever is operated, the system starts the obstacle detection operation.
If a sensor is found to have an anomaly due to an open circuit, the buzzer sounds after the initial check function is completed to inform the driver and indicate which sensor is abnormal.

DETECTION RANGE MEASUREMENT AND INDICATOR CHECK
CAUTION:
Apply the parking brake securely so that the vehicle does not move.
Turn the ignition switch to ON.
Turn the back sonar or clearance sonar switch on.
Move the shift lever to R to check the rear corner sensors and rear center sensors.
Move a pole around the sensor to measure the detection range of the sensor.
Note
These detection ranges are applicable when positioning a pole with a diameter of 60 mm (2.36 in.) parallel or perpendicular to the ground.
The ranges vary depending on the measuring method and type of obstacle (such as walls).
For close-range and medium-range detection, the values shown are for when using a pole with a diameter of 60 mm (2.36 in.). For long-range detection, the values shown are for when using walls.

Check that the buzzer sounds with the back sonar or clearance sonar switch on.
| Detection | Distance |
|---|---|
| 1. Close-range detection | Within 300 +/-30 mm (11.8 +/-1.18 in.) |
| 2. Medium-range detection | 300 +/-30 to 400 +/-40 mm (11.8 +/-1.18 to 15.7 +/-1.57 in.) |
| 3. Long-range detection | 400 +/-40 to 500 +/-60 mm (15.7 +/-1.57 to 19.7 +/-2.36 in.) |
| Detection | Distance |
|---|---|
| 1. Close-range detection | Within 400 +/-40 mm (15.7 +/-1.57 in.) |
| 2. Medium-range detection | 400 +/-40 to 500 +/-50 mm (15.7 +/-1.57 to 19.7 +/-1.97 in.) |
| 3. Long-range detection | 500 +/-50 to 650 +/-70 mm (19.7 +/-1.97 to 25.6 +/-2.76 in.) |
| 4. Maximum long-range detection | 650 +/-70 to 1500 +/-150 mm (25.6 +/-2.76 to 59.1+/-5.91 in.) |

Ultrasonic waves are used to measure the detection range. However, the detection range may vary depending on the ambient temperature.
Check the indicator and buzzer when the rear center sensors and rear corner sensors have detected an obstacle.
| Ignition Switch | Back Sonar or Clearance Sonar Switch | Shift Lever Position |
|---|---|---|
| ON | On | R |
| Detection Range | Buzzer |
|---|---|
| 1. Close-range detection | Sounds continuously |
| 2. Medium-range detection | Sounds intermittently (On: Approximately 0.1 seconds./Off: Approximately 0.1 seconds.) |
| 3. Long-range detection | Sounds intermittently (On: Approximately 0.2 seconds./Off: Approximately 0.2 seconds.) |
| 4. Maximum long-range detection | Sounds intermittently (On: Approximately 0.5 seconds./Off: Approximately 0.5 seconds.) |
| Detection Range | Indicator Displayed |
|---|---|
| 1. Close-range detection | Corner indicator(s) are illuminated and/or back indicator is illuminated |
| 2. Medium-range detection | Corner indicator(s) are blinking and/or back indicator is blinking |
| 3. Long-range detection | Corner indicator(s) are blinking and/or back indicator is blinking |
| 4. Maximum long-range detection | Back indicator is blinking |
